About Acriopsis
Acriopsis, recognized by the common name "chandelier orchids" and in Chinese as 合萼兰属 (he e lan shu), is a genus of herbaceous flowering plants belonging to the Orchidaceae family. These orchids are characterized by their epiphytic growth habit, meaning they grow on other plants, typically trees, rather than in soil. They are found across a broad geographical range that includes India, Yunnan, Southeast Asia, New Guinea, Melanesia, Micronesia, and Queensland, Australia.
Growth and Morphology
Plants within the Acriopsis genus typically feature spherical or cylindrical pseudobulbs and possess creeping, branched rhizomes from which thin, white roots emerge. These roots are noteworthy for their specialized aerial growth, developing branches that facilitate the absorption of nutrients from airborne litter and debris. Each plant usually bears two to three leaves. The genus is known for producing numerous small flowers, which are non-resupinate. The flowers have lateral sepals that are fused along their edges, spreading petals, and a distinctive three-lobed labellum. A unique feature of the Acriopsis column is the presence of projections that extend in a hood-like manner beyond the anther, contributing to the genus's characteristic appearance.
Taxonomy and Naming
The genus Acriopsis was first formally described by Carl Ludwig Blume in 1825. The scientific name "Acriopsis" is derived from the Ancient Greek words "akris," meaning "locust" or "grasshopper," and "opsis," meaning "having the appearance of" or "like." This etymology reflects the grasshopper-like shape observed in the orchid's column.
Habitat and Distribution
Acriopsis orchids primarily inhabit low-lying, humid rainforest environments. While they generally prefer these conditions, some species may ascend to medium altitudes. Their distribution spans a wide area, encompassing numerous regions in Asia and Oceania. The specific species, such as Acriopsis indica and Acriopsis liliifolia, have detailed distributions within these broader regions, with some varieties like Acriopsis liliifolia var. liliifolia being found across many islands and mainland areas from Assam and Sikkim to New Guinea and the Caroline Islands.

Dienia
Dienia, commonly known as snout orchids, is a genus of six species of evergreen orchids found across Southeast Asia, Australia, Micronesia, and Melanesia. These plants are characterized by their fleshy, above-ground stems, large pleated leaves, and small, non-resupinate flowers with a distinctive short, tongue-like labellum. While primarily terrestrial, some species can grow as epiphytes.

Geodorum
Geodorum is a genus of eight deciduous, terrestrial orchid species found across southern Japan, tropical Asia, Australia, and the southwest Pacific islands. These orchids are distinguished by their underground pseudobulbs, broad pleated leaves, and small to medium-sized, bell-shaped or tube-shaped flowers that hang downwards on a drooping flowering stem.
